LA7688
Single-Chip Signal-Processing Circuit NTSC Formats
Overview
LA7688 integrates VIF, SIF, video, chrominance, deflection processing circuits PAL/NTSC format sets single chip provided 52-pin shrink package. circuits achieve semi-adjustment-free operation, adjustment-free except coil circuit. chrominance circuit made adjustment-free using LC89950 delay line signal processing required multi-format color implemented combining this product with LA7642 SECAM decoder
